Meaning, origin, history

Ahmirah is a unique and captivating feminine given name of Arabic origin. Derived from the Arabic word "ahmar," which means "red," Ahmirah signifies the color red, often associated with passion, energy, and vibrancy. This distinctive name adds an exotic touch to its bearer's identity while retaining a strong connection to Middle Eastern culture. The history behind Ahmirah is deeply rooted in Arabic tradition. The name has been passed down through generations of families who value their heritage and culture. It is often chosen for daughters as a means of honoring family lineage or expressing a desire for the child to embody the strength, courage, and beauty symbolized by the color red. Ahmirah has gained popularity beyond its Arabic roots due to its unique sound and meaning. Today, it can be found among diverse communities around the world, with parents choosing this name for their daughters as an expression of individuality and a celebration of cultural richness.
